NFSv4 and SELinux

I've just installed Fedora 9 today in order to test NFSv4 through SELinux.
I know that sending context across the wire is still in progress, but
could I find some patch to test? Is there anything I could test to make it
work?
I also would like to make the context mount option work with NFSv4. The
mount command doesn't give any error at mounting but when I list the
context of the NFSv4 mount point I get "system_u:object_r:nfs_t". Is there
any way to set context for the mounted points?
